. In this snapshot, David McCarthy & Dae Sasitorn take us on an awe-inspiring journey into the hidden world of radiolarians. Meet Lychnocanomma bellum, a single-celled marvel that rules the microscopic realm with its exquisitely delicate skeleton. Zooming in at an astonishing x960 magnification, this Scanning Electron Micrograph (SEM) print reveals a mesmerizing pattern reminiscent of a kaleidoscope. The intricate design showcases nature's unparalleled creativity and leaves us marveling at its sheer beauty. Radiolarians are like zooplankton architects, crafting their skeletons from silica secretions found in marine environments. These minuscule creatures play a vital role in our oceans' ecosystems as they drift through the water column, providing food for larger organisms.
